John,
I also really like the Scalar, but this is not the first time I've heard
about this problem between NetBackup and the Scalar 1000. I wonder if this
is a problem with NetBackup, or with goofiness associated with the
Scalar? I wonder if the 10,000 also has this problem.
I wonder if this problem will exist forever, or if someone at Veritas is
working with anyone at ADIC to make this problem go away.
At 01:49 PM 9/4/2001 -0500, John_Wang AT enron DOT net wrote:
>The ADIC Scalar 1000 starts off with one cabinet holding 237 slots and 12
>drives
>(if you use AIT2 technology) and is expandable to four cabinets either
>with slot
>only or slot and drives cabinets (a maximum of 1,024 slots). I've got
>three of
>them and they have worked reasonably well. One thing I don't like is that
>Netbackup has difficulty ejecting more than one tape at a time on the Scalar
>1000's even though the I/E port holds 18 tapes (Basically the vmchange -e -s
>command doesn't leave the tape in the I/E port after the timeout as it does on
>other changers so the ejection is either one at a time or scripted slot to
>mail
>slot instead of tape to mail slot). Another thing that I don't like is that
>the I/E port's slots are fixed in the drawer so you still have to manually
>pull
>the tapes out of the slots after pulling the drawer out, it would be nice to
>have a magazine that one could pre-load and just swap like the
>Exabytes. Other
>than that, it's fast, inexpensive, I've only had to replace the gripper
>once and
>so far no dropped tapes.
